Phoenix International Holdings Names Travis Niederhauser as New President

Leadership Transition at Phoenix International Holdings

Phoenix International Holdings, Inc. (Phoenix) has announced a key leadership change, appointing Travis Niederhauser as President, effective 1 August 2026.

Niederhauser succeeds Patrick Keenan, who will transition to the company’s Board of Directors. Keenan’s move to the board follows a distinguished tenure leading Phoenix’s operational and strategic initiatives in the maritime sector.

Niederhauser’s Background and Vision

With a robust career in marine engineering and subsea operations, Niederhauser brings extensive experience to his new role. His prior leadership positions within Phoenix have been instrumental in advancing the company’s capabilities in underwater technology, salvage operations, and offshore support services.

In a statement, Phoenix’s executive leadership expressed confidence in Niederhauser’s ability to drive innovation and maintain the company’s position as a leader in maritime solutions. His focus will include strengthening client partnerships, expanding operational efficiency, and reinforcing safety standards across all divisions.
